WebMar 13, 2024 · A Bartholin's duct cyst is a non-infectious occlusion of the distal Bartholin's duct, with resultant retention of secretions. WebAn ovarian cyst is a larger fluid-filled sac (more than 3 cm in diameter) that develops on or in an ovary. A cyst can vary in size from a few centimetres to the size of a large melon. Ovarian cysts may be thin-walled . and only contain fluid (known as a simple cyst) or they may be more complex, containing thick fluid, blood or solid areas.
